There wasnt a whole lot of option for me when I decided to but my first road bike. It had to be SUZUKI and it had to be a GSXR 750. I grew up on Suzuki´s. I still love my old PE 250. The GIXXER is good for just on 240 Kph. (I had the front sprocket changed, dropped 2 teeth off to give it more acceleration. It was good for 270 Kph before that) Clocks the standing quarter-mile in 11.5 sec (half a sec away from immortality!). Yoshi cams, jet kit, full Megacycle 4 in to 1 system, ported, polished head, 180 Michellin Pilot Power rear, White Power fully adjustable shock pretty much is all the work it has. There is a ´92 GSXR 1100 engine waiting to be transplanted, once I get all the internal goodies ready. I want the old girl to see 290+ Kph and a low 10 sec pass at the drags. Maybe my dream will come true. Only time (and $$) will tell.
